Date: 2011-03-01. factory CNC programming examples Gifted (UG NX6 Edition) to solve the problem of mold factory CNC programming as a fundamental starting point. focusing on UG NX6 software programming CNC milling characteristics and selection of parameters of attention. Finally. through examples to explain the programming process. and for UG NX7 increase in CNC programming features introduced by the examples given to explain and Tactical Training. for a 3D graphics based CNC programming and want to learn CNC programming engineers who wish to become readers. Factory CNC programming examples Gifted (UG NX6 Edition) is characterized by: the author from the factory production line. from the factory case and implementation practices. case exercises a rich. reliable and practical lessons learned. reflect the real CNC programming engineer work process. Factory CNC programming examples Gifted (UG NX6 Edition) was a plant engineer and social training CNC programming training materials are re-refined to publicly published to enable more readers to learn how to use software for CNC UG programming. UG CNC programming to help those interested in those detours. fewer mistakes. so as soon as possible to jobs in the industry to achieve the goal of life. Taking into account just released a new version of UG NX7. NC programming technology factory instance Gifted (UG NX6 Edition) not only for UG NX6 user is also suitable for UG NX7 users learn to use.
